Why Polluted and Compacted Soils Are a Problem

Healthy soil contains tiny pockets of air and water that roots need to grow. When soil becomes compacted, these spaces disappear, making it difficult for roots to expand and absorb nutrients. Pollution can further stress trees by introducing harmful chemicals and reducing overall soil quality.

Trees suited for these conditions typically have:

  • Strong, adaptable root systems
  • High tolerance to air pollution
  • Resistance to drought and heat
  • Ability to grow in poor-quality soils
  • Long lifespans with minimal maintenance

1. London Plane Tree (Platanus × acerifolia)

One of the most dependable urban trees, the London Plane has been planted in cities worldwide for centuries. It tolerates pollution, compacted soils, drought, and pruning better than almost any other large shade tree.

Best for:

  • City streets
  • Parks
  • Commercial landscapes
  • Downtown areas

2. Honey Locust (Gleditsia triacanthos var. inermis)

Thornless Honey Locust varieties offer filtered shade and exceptional adaptability. They handle compacted soils, heat, road salt, and air pollution with ease.

Highlights:

  • Fast growing
  • Small leaflets create light shade
  • Attractive golden fall color
  • Low maintenance

3. Ginkgo (Ginkgo biloba)

Known as a living fossil, the Ginkgo is incredibly resilient. It tolerates pollution, insects, disease, and compacted urban soils while living for hundreds of years.

Benefits:

  • Outstanding golden autumn foliage
  • Extremely pest resistant
  • Excellent street tree
  • Long lifespan

4. Northern Red Oak (Quercus rubra)

This native oak adapts surprisingly well to urban environments when established. It develops into a magnificent shade tree while tolerating moderate pollution and compacted ground.

Ideal for:

  • Large lawns
  • Parks
  • Greenbelts
  • Residential landscapes

5. Hackberry (Celtis occidentalis)

Hackberry is often overlooked but is one of North America's toughest native trees. It tolerates poor soils, drought, wind, and urban pollution remarkably well.

Advantages:

  • Fast growth
  • Wildlife-friendly berries
  • Excellent adaptability
  • Hardy across much of the U.S.

6. Kentucky Coffeetree (Gymnocladus dioicus)

With its bold branching structure and large leaves, Kentucky Coffeetree thrives where many other species fail. It handles compacted soil, drought, and city pollution exceptionally well.

Features:

  • Distinctive winter silhouette
  • Very tolerant of difficult sites
  • Low pest problems

7. American Elm (Disease-Resistant Cultivars)

Modern disease-resistant elm varieties have brought this classic shade tree back to city landscapes. They tolerate compacted soil, heat, and urban conditions while recreating the graceful canopy once common along streets.

Popular cultivars include:

  • 'Princeton'
  • 'Valley Forge'
  • 'New Harmony'

8. Japanese Zelkova (Zelkova serrata)

Often planted as an elm substitute, Japanese Zelkova performs exceptionally well in cities thanks to its pollution tolerance and adaptability.

Why gardeners love it:

  • Attractive vase-shaped form
  • Beautiful orange to red fall color
  • Strong resistance to urban stress

9. Bald Cypress (Taxodium distichum)

Although famous for growing in wetlands, Bald Cypress adapts surprisingly well to compacted urban soils once established. It also tolerates pollution and seasonal flooding.

Excellent for:

  • Parks
  • Stormwater management
  • Difficult planting sites
  • Large landscapes

10. Callery Pear (Sterile or Improved Cultivars Where Appropriate)

While traditional Bradford Pear has fallen out of favor due to structural weaknesses and invasiveness concerns, some improved sterile cultivars perform well in challenging urban environments where permitted.

Benefits:

  • Excellent pollution tolerance
  • Attractive spring flowers
  • Fast establishment

Always check local recommendations before planting Callery Pear varieties, as some regions discourage or prohibit them.


Tips for Planting in Compacted Soil

Even tough trees benefit from proper planting techniques.

  • Loosen the soil well beyond the planting hole.
  • Mix organic compost into the surrounding soil when appropriate.
  • Apply 2–4 inches of mulch while keeping it away from the trunk.
  • Water deeply during the first two growing seasons.
  • Avoid parking vehicles or heavy equipment near newly planted trees.
